Front assist "recalibration"

Featured Replies

Apparently my car needs this but my Skoda dealer doesn't have the wherewithal to carry it out.

What does it mean?

Dill

The special tools and test equipment required to carry this out are expensive, and not all dealers have it. If you read any of the other VW Audi Group forums you will see this as a common issue. Generally the larger VW or Audi franchises in towns / cities have the kit. Might be worth a call to Skoda UK or Skoda Assist to find out where you can take it. Until then you can switch the FA off.

I had this.

My dealer was very open with me about it.

He said this is a new thing for Skodas and they haven't got the facility in-house yet. He said there is a fairly high outlay for the necessary equipment plus the training course for two mechanics.

In the interim, he pointed me in the direction of my nearest Audi Garage about five miles away.
